About the role
The SD Rehabilitation Center for the Blind is seeking a Senior Secretary to support our mission of empowering individuals with vision loss. This is a Full-Time 40 Hours Weekly position.
Responsibilities
- Answer and route phone calls; assist staff and clients professionally.
- Maintain physical and digital office filing systems.
- Track, organize, and assist in preparing weekly client schedules with Center Counselor.
- Process invoices, create payment vouchers, and track payment status.
- Absorb and assist with procurement card statements and monthly billing submissions.
- Order office and program supplies for Rehab Center and field offices using approved state purchasing systems.
- Manage client files and assist with onboarding referrals.
- Coordinate consumer satisfaction surveys and certificates for completed training programs.
- Help facilitate events such as Transition Week, Low Vision Clinics, and other projects as assigned.
- Provide basic tech support to staff and maintain training computers.
- Update software and assist with adaptive technology tools.
- Maintain attendance and reporting documents (including Power BI input).
- Compile and submit reports for client attendance, training hours, satisfaction surveys, and inventory.
- Support outreach efforts by distributing flyers, forms, and templates to field staff.
- Schedule and track maintenance for the state vehicle.
- Manage postage, mailings, and errands for Center operations.
